Crazy Quilting Supplies from Evening Star DesignsWhat Kind of Embroidery Needle Do I Need?
06 8th, 2008You’ve got everything you need for your quilting project. You stocked up on fabric, thread, and yarn. You purchased and planned your pattern. Now all you need is the embroidery needles. But which one should you choose?
Embroidery needles are an absolutely essential part of the quilting process. You must purchase the correct kind if you want the best end results. So before you pick up any old needle, keep the following tips in mind.
-Check the needle’s size. There are a variety of sizes, but it’s good to remember (especially for online purchases) that higher numbers mean finer needles.
-Choose your needle depending on the thread size, not the other way around. The needle should be just larger than your thread, creating an easy hole for the thread.
-Also choose your needle on the type of project. Select a crewel or chenille needle if you need to completely penetrate fabric. If you are doing work near the surface of the fabric, a blunt tapestry needle would be most effective.
